To change the units used for the temperature in the Weather app:

  1. In the Fitbit app, tap the Today tab 
     
     > your profile picture > your device image > Apps.
  2. Tap the gear icon 
     
     next to Weather. You may need to swipe up to find the app.
  3. In the Temperature Unit section, tap Units and choose the unit you want to use.
  4. Sync your device and then open the Weather app 
     
    ​ on your device to see the updated units.
